加入收藏 | 设为首页 | 会员中心 | 我要投稿 南昌站长网 (https://www.0791zz.cn/)- 终端安全、安全管理、数据治理、图像分析、大数据!
当前位置: 首页 > 站长资讯 > 传媒 > 正文

新一代的键值存储 KVell · SOSP

发布时间:2021-02-05 15:48:56 所属栏目:传媒 来源:互联网
导读:就像上图所示的一样,如果我们手动删除红框中的空白,那将会是很无聊的,需要按很多次退格键,这时我们可以按住option(Win下为Alt)键,此时光标会变成十字形,现在就可以选中目标区域一次性删除 6. 直接获取文档 如果我们需要查看某些函数的用法,可能需要通

就像上图所示的一样,如果我们手动删除红框中的空白,那将会是很无聊的,需要按很多次退格键,这时我们可以按住option(Win下为Alt)键,此时光标会变成十字形,现在就可以选中目标区域一次性删除👇

6. 直接获取文档

如果我们需要查看某些函数的用法,可能需要通过百度或者查找官方文档,额外打开很多页面来检索,其实在Notebook中可以使用Shift + Tab直接获取该方法的文档

就像上图一样,直接显示pd.merge的用法,一目了然,点开还能查看更详细的解释👇

7. 加载外部文件

还是魔法命令,使用%load 可以直接加载外部文件,比如%load test.py就可以直接在notebook中打开对应文件,省去切换页面-复制粘贴的时间。

直接打开在线文档也是可以的,比如打开Matplotlib官方文档中的示例代码
 

实在Notebook中也可以使用markdown语句,写文字、打公式、贴图片都很轻松,就像上图一样只需要选中目标单元格,然后按下ESC,再按下M即可,也可以在菜单栏将当前单元格转为标签

3. 快速计算运行时间

有时候我们需要计算一些函数或过程运行时间,以此来衡量代码的效率,在其他IDE可能需要写个函数或者使用第三方模块来完成,而在Notebook中,提供了便捷的魔法函数👇

  • %time:在行模式下,代码运行一次所花费的时间
  • %%time:在单元模式下,代码运行一次所花费的时间
  • %timeit:在行模式下,执行代码块若干次,取最佳结果
  • %%timeit:在单元模式下,执行代码块若干次,取最佳结果

这样我们只要敲几下键盘,就能快速得到代码块的运行时间👇
 

图 14:左图展示了相互避碰时的两种对称规则,上面为左手规则,下面为右手规则。右图是在 SA-CADRL 方法中模型引入这样的对称性信息,第一层中的红色段表示当前智能体的观测值,蓝色块表示它考虑的附近三个智能体的观测值,权重矩阵的对称性是考虑了智能体之间遵循一定规则的对称行为。图源:[16]

4. 总结

多智能体强化学习(MARL)是结合了强化学习和多智能体学习这两个领域的重要研究方向,关注的是多个智能体的序贯决策问题。本篇文章主要基于智能体之间的关系类型,包括完全合作式、完全竞争式和混合关系式,对多智能体强化学习的理论和算法展开介绍,并在应用方面列举了一些相关的研究工作。在未来,对 MARL 方面的研究(包括理论层面和应用层面)仍然需要解决较多的问题,包括理论体系的补充和完善、方法的可复现性、模型参数的训练和计算量、模型的安全性和鲁棒性等 [15]。

(编辑:南昌站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读